Wet land filler of immobilized microorganism and preparation method thereof
A technology for immobilizing microorganisms and wetlands, applied in chemical instruments and methods, sustainable biological treatment, biological water/sewage treatment, etc., can solve the problems of long biofilm growth cycle, biofilm bacterial contamination, specificity and efficiency of pollutant removal Low-level problems, to achieve the effect of strong phosphorus removal effect

Embodiment 1
[0020] Weigh 1kg of cement, 4kg of limestone and 0.2kg of lime according to the weight ratio of cement: limestone: lime=1:4:0.2, mix the above materials, add water and stir to form a slurry; add 0.274kg quick-setting agent aluminum sulfate to the slurry and stir evenly ;Quickly add solid strain capsules, stir well; extrude Φ35 strips from extruder, cut into 35mm pieces by cutting machine. After stacking for three days, completely dry to obtain the product of the present invention.
